30 killed in northwest Nigeria village attack, residents report

In the sweltering northwestern Niger State of Nigeria, armed assailants have unleashed a wave of violence, claiming at least 30 lives in three villages. Residents fleeing the carnage relay harrowing accounts to Reuters.

The attacks unfolded early Saturday, with sporadic gunfire marking the onset of chaos in Tunga-Makeri village and Konkoso. Wasiu Abiodun, the police spokesperson for Niger State, confirmed these gruesome raids on Tunga-Makeri but remained vague about subsequent operations targeting Konkso and another location.

Abiodun’s statement underscores the severity of the situation: “Suspected bandits invaded Tunga-Makeri village… six persons lost their lives, some houses were also set ablaze. Further details are unclear.”

A local witness named Jeremiah Timothy detailed his ordeal in Konkoso. He recounted how attackers entered the village at 6 a.m., igniting the police station and indiscriminately shooting residents. Residents reported hearing military aircraft overhead as the violence escalated.

In another village, Tunga-Makeri, Auwal Ibrahim described the assault: “The bandits stormed our town around 3 a.m., riding numerous motorcycles while beheading six people and killing others. They set shops on fire and forced the whole village to flee.”

Ibrahim’s account paints a grim picture of ongoing insecurity in the region. Many villagers express fear over returning, fearing gunmen remain close by.

The surge in such attacks has placed immense pressure on Nigeria’s government to restore peace amid escalating communal violence across northern Nigeria. These incidents have drawn international attention and criticism for the failure to address persistent security issues plaguing the country.
